Cardi B Misses Court Date Judge Threatens to Issue Warrant – Details Here!

Cardi B was a no-show at her court date in New York yesterday (December 3) in which she was schedule to enter a plea in her pending case. The case stems from an incident this past summer which Cardi B is charged with allegedly ordering the beating of two strip club bartenders. Her legal team reportedly told the judge they were unable to get in touch with her and had no idea where to find her.

The eager prosecutors in the case reportedly asked the judge to issue a bench warrant for the star’s arrest. They cited the fact that they had already given the star and her legal team a six-week extension in the case. Lucky for Cardi, the judge in the case denied their request. However, the judge demands that Cardi B attend the next hearing scheduled for Friday, December 7 or a warrant will be issued for her arrest.

The strip club bartenders Cardi B is accused of allegedly ordering the attack on, are named Jade and Baddie Gi. Although Cardi and Nicki are supposed to have a truce, Both ladies are featured in Nicki’s latest video “Good Form.”
